The Cavaliers and Suns both recorded impressive road wins on Friday night.

- Cleveland 124, Boston 85

Team FIC Differential: Cavaliers +40.6, Celtics -40.6

The Cleveland Cavaliers (2-1) jumped out to an early lead against the Boston Celtics (1-2) and never looked back on Friday night at the TD Garden. LeBron James starred with 38 points, eight rebounds and seven assists, Antawn Jamison posted 20 points and 12 boards and Maurice Williams added 12 points and seven dimes. Cleveland hit 59% of their shots and outrebounded Boston by fifteen. Kevin Garnett scored a team-high 19 points, Rajon Rondo tallied 18 points, eight assists and five rebounds and Paul Pierce managed just 11 points and four boards.

- Phoenix 110, San Antonio 96

Team FIC Differential: Suns +10.1, Spurs -10.1

The Phoenix Suns (3-0) outscored the San Antonio Spurs (0-3) by 20 points in the second half en route to an impressive victory. Goran Dragic led with 26 points, Steve Nash tallied 16 points, eight rebounds and six assists and Jason Richardson put up 21 points. Phoenix shot 53% on the night, including 15-for-26 from three-point land. Manu Ginobili had 27 points and five assists, Tim Duncan posted 15 points and 13 rebounds and Antonio McDyess chipped in 12 points and 10 boards in the loss.

? RealGM calculates the Floor Impact Counter using the following formula: (Points + .75 Defensive Rebounds + Offensive Rebounds + Steals + Assists + Blocks - .75 Field Goal Attempts - .375 Free Throw Attempts - Turnovers - .5 Personal Fouls)

( )'s indicate a negative FIC score.
